Courgette, pineapple and coconut loaf
I am not going to tell you that this loaf is healthy or good for you but take a closer look: courgettes and pineapple (two of your five-a-day), and coconut. And it's CAKE so that's a win-win, right? I know what you're thinking. Step away from the vegetable drawer. But stop a second and consider the carrot cake. A vegetable. One that's quite sweet and full of goodness. And we all know what happens when you put carrots in a cake: you get dense, moist, not-too-sweet cakey loveliness. Courgettes take the results to a whole new nutty level, and the pineapple and coconut add a tropical twist. I think this cake is moist and flavourful enough not to need icing but you may not agree, in which case a cream-cheese combo a la carrot cake would work well, as would a chocolate ganache if you're trying to camouflage the cake's central theme (no one will guess, but don't ask them to try until they've had three slices).
